Servings: 1

 

Ingredients:

cola

1/2 oz. of gin

ice

1/2 oz. of peach schnapps

1/2 oz. of rum

1/2 oz. of tequila

1/2 oz. of vodka

1 to 1 1/2 oz. of sour mix

Equipment:

Cooking instruction summary:

InstructionsPour the tequila, gin, vodka, rum, peach schnapps and sour mix into a tall glass. Add ice. Mix. Add enough cola to fill the glass. Serve.
